Come and see the exciting Quilters Exhibition.

There are more than thirty quilts featured in this exhibition by London Quilters (LQ). Quilts appear in every colour of the rainbow and range from A4 to bed size. They include both traditional and contemporary designs but all reflect the passion of their makers. Some of the quilts are by professional textile artists although for others this is the first time they have displayed their work.

The centre piece of the exhibition is the "Dear Jane" quilt inspired by Jane Stickle’s 1863 original. The 169 square patches in the quilt vary. Members of LQ each sewed and donated the blocks before they were sewn together and quilted by the group. The finished quilt which is reproduced on the exhibition invitation will be raffled for charity.


During the period of the exhibition, members of LQ will be on hand to talk about the quilts, their inspiration and the techniques used to create them.

London Quilters
London Quilters is a group of around 60 textile enthusiasts who meet monthly at the Crossfield Centre in Camden.  As well as listening to talks from leading figures in patchwork, quilting and related subjects, they take the opportunity to share their recent work and experiences with other members.  Details of future meetings are given on the LQ website.  New members and visitors are welcome.
